Colgate Looks To Aging Gums, Whitening Launches For Growth In 2012
This article was originally published in The Rose Sheet
Executive Summary
Colgate-Palmolive plans oral-care launches in 2012 aimed at aging consumers seeking gum protection as well as consumers looking for “a shinier, sparkling smile.” Firm reports fiscal 2011 sales of $16.7 billion, up 7.5% from the year prior.
